Hazlitt Grove - B30 1BG
Key Street Insights
Hazlitt Grove is a residential street with 6 addresses.
It ranks as the 16th largest and 47th most expensive of the 250 streets in the B30 area. The most common property type is a mid-century house built between 1936 and 1979.
The street contains a total of 6 properties: 5 houses and 1 other property.

Sales Market Trends
The last sale on Hazlitt Grove sold for £195,000 on 21st October 2022. Since then prices are up an average of 7.6%.
The current average value in the street is £200,882.
The Hazlitt Grove Sales Market has increased by 62.6% over the last 10 years.
